Voices of the Maine Fishermen’s Forum
Rustin Taylor, Somesville, Maine
Rustin Taylor, from Somesville, ME, is an elver fisherman who fishes around Mount Desert Island and Ellsworth. He talks about the changes in the fishery over time and the environmental balances to consider when fishing. He explains some of the factors that affect this fishery, such as water level fluctuations caused by the Union River Dam and the quota system established after the 2013 season.
Interviewed by Natalie Springuel at the Maine Fishermen’s Forum, 2018.
